27 Apr Chad Conquering Lion “MADE ME DO THIS” (Official Music Video)
New Orleans rap artist drops his latest video Chad Conquering Lion “MADE ME DO THIS”
The post Chad Conquering Lion “MADE ME DO THIS” (Official Music Video) first appeared on Siccness Network.
Powered by WPeMatico
Please follow and like us:
Sorry, the comment form is closed at this time.